you can take a cat nap ..those range anywhere from 10-45 minutes, but sometimes if you're really tired, you won't pull yourself out of bed. So try taking a shower or listening to some music and getting really into it. You're probably falling asleep and it's hard to concentrate because you are really bored. Go do something for 30 minutes and clear your mind, then go back to it. You should feel refreshed and ready to start again.
